Nepal Govt to build Budhi Gandaki hydroelectricity project through a public limited company

Kathmandu: Nepal to build Budhi Gandaki hydroelectricity project through a separate company .The government has decided to set up a separate company to develop the Budhi Gandaki Hydropower Project, a storage-type hydropower project, which will be the country’s largest hydro project once it is built..

Minister for Energy, Water Resources and Irrigation Pampha Bhusal has taken a proposal to cabinet to open a public company for the construction of 1,200 MW Budhi Gandaki Hydropower Project.

A meeting of the Council of Ministers held Tuesday took such a decision on this reservoir-based project with the capacity of 1,200 megawatt at the proposal of the Ministry of Energy, Water Resource and Irrigation.

The project was stalled for long for delayed decision whether to construct the project with domestic investment or giving it to some foreign companies.
